Husky Skiers Open 2016-17 Season at West Yellowstone Ski Festival

WEST YELLOWSTONE, Mont. – The Michigan Tech men's and women's skiing teams kicked off the 2016-17 season on Friday at the annual West Yellowstone Ski Festival. It was a deep field of talented competitors once again this year.

"I thought the day was a good start to the season," Michigan Tech Head Coach Joe Haggenmiller said. "We took it low key and have had a higher priority on good training volume this week. With that I thought Gaspard, Dan, and Carolyn had good efforts and solid results. Gaspard was hanging well with the top college guys. We'll look to build on this tomorrow."

In the freestyle, Gaspard Cuenot led the men with a 12th place finish overall and in the senior division with a time of 21:37.0. Dan Wood followed in 30th place overall with a time of 22:54.6, and Seth Mares checked in 76th overall, crossing the line with a time of 26:10.4.

In the women's freestyle, Carolyn Lucca led the way in 21st place in the senior division while checking in at No. 38 overall with a time of 13:35.8. Teammate Sarah Wade was 53rd in the overall freestyle standings on the strength of a 14:37.3 time Friday.

In the Altius Biathlon, Amanda Kautzer won her division with a time of 25:55 earlier this week.

The Huskies are once again scheduled to compete on Saturday at the West Yellowstone Ski Festival.
